Category:London Road Car Company (bus company)

From Wikimedia Commons, the free media repository
Jump to navigation Jump to search
English: The London Road Car Company Ltd, aka 'Union Jack' due to their habit of flying the flag from vehicles/displaying it on running boards, was established in 1890, initially running horse bus services. As of 1905 it was building its own horse and steam car buses at its Seagrave Road works. In 1909 it was bought by the London General Omnibus Company.

Subcategories

This category has only the following subcategory.